Understanding Video SEO

Video SEO (Search Engine Optimization) is the process of optimizing your video content to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s). It involves several strategies and techniques aimed at making your videos more discoverable by search engines like Google and video platforms such as YouTube.

Key Components of Video SEO

  • Keyword Research and Optimization: Identifying and using relevant keywords that your audience is searching for.
  • Video Metadata: Optimizing titles, descriptions, and tags with these keywords.
  • Transcriptions and Captions: Adding text versions of your video’s audio to improve accessibility and searchability.

By implementing these components, you can significantly enhance your video’s visibility, driving more traffic to your website and increasing engagement with your content.

Best Practices for Video SEO

To reap the benefits of Video SEO, it’s essential to follow best practices and continually refine your strategies.

Conduct Thorough Keyword Research

Identify the keywords that are relevant to your audience and content.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, and SEMrush to find popular search terms. Integrate these keywords naturally into your video titles, descriptions, and tags.

Optimize Video Titles and Descriptions

Create compelling titles that include your target keywords. Your descriptions should be detailed and informative, providing a summary of the video’s content while incorporating relevant keywords.

Use Appropriate Tags and Categories

Tags help categorize your video content and make it easier for search engines to understand its context. Use a mix of broad and specific tags related to your video’s content.

Create High-Quality, Engaging Thumbnails

A thumbnail is often the first thing a viewer sees, so make it count. Use high-quality images and include text overlays that convey the video’s topic. Thumbnails should be visually appealing and relevant to the content.

Add Transcriptions and Captions

Transcriptions and captions not only improve accessibility for viewers with hearing impairments but also provide search engines with text to crawl, enhancing your video’s SEO. Services like Rev or automated tools on platforms like YouTube can assist in generating transcriptions.

Embed Videos on Your Website and Use Video Sitemaps

Embedding videos on your website can drive traffic from search engines directly to your site. Additionally, submitting a video sitemap to search engines can help them discover and index your video content more efficiently.

Tools and Platforms to Enhance Video SEO

Several tools and platforms can help you optimize your video content and track its performance.

  • YouTube: The second-largest search engine in the world, offering extensive SEO features.
  • Vimeo: Known for high-quality video hosting and a professional audience.
  • Wistia: Focuses on business video hosting with detailed analytics and SEO tools.

SEO Tools

  • Google Keyword Planner: Essential for finding relevant keywords.
  • Ahrefs and SEMrush: Comprehensive tools for keyword research and competitive analysis.
  • TubeBuddy: A browser extension that offers keyword insights specifically for YouTube.

Video Analytics Tools

  • YouTube Analytics: Provides insights into video performance, audience demographics, and engagement.
  • Google Analytics: Tracks the performance of embedded videos on your website.
  • Vidyard: Offers advanced video analytics and insights to help refine your strategy.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Video SEO

Even with the best intentions, some common pitfalls can hinder your Video SEO efforts.

Overlooking Keyword Research

Failing to research and use the right keywords can result in your videos being overlooked by search engines and your target audience.

Neglecting Video Metadata

Skipping detailed titles, descriptions, and tags can make it difficult for search engines to understand your video content, affecting its visibility.

Poor-Quality Video Production

Low-quality videos can deter viewers and harm your brand’s reputation. Invest in good equipment and editing software to produce high-quality content.

Ignoring Thumbnails and Captions

Overlooking the importance of eye-catching thumbnails and accurate captions can reduce your video’s appeal and accessibility, impacting engagement and SEO.

Not Leveraging Video Analytics

Without tracking your video’s performance, it’s challenging to understand what works and what doesn’t. Regularly review analytics to refine your strategy and improve results.
